The present study was undertaken to develop an integrated disease management module for the management of Fusarium root rot in chilli grown under Kashmir conditions. Among the single treatments tested under in vitro conditions, a minimum wilt incidence of 2.0, 13.1 and 33.6% at flowering, fruit formation and ripening stages, respectively, was recorded in carbendazim 50 WP treatment [@ 0.1%] with fruit yield of 73.25 q ha−1 as compared to 42.50 q ha−1 in check. Integrated treatments (carbendazim 50 WP @ 0.1% + FYM @ 20 t ha−1) showed minimum wilt incidence of 1.1, 9.0 and 27.5% at the above respective stages with fruit yield of 75.85 q h−1. The treatment ‘Trichoderma viride application @ 0.16 t ha−1 + carbendazim 50 WP @ 0.1% + delayed irrigation (14 days interval) + FYM application @ 20 t ha−1’ recorded significantly least wilt incidence of 0.6, 6.2 and 18.1% at flowering, fruit formation and ripening stages, respectively, with a fruit yield of 84.25 q ha−1.
